Synthesis of urine drug metabolites: Glucuronosyl esters of carboxymefloquine, indoprofen, (S)-naproxen, and desmethyl (S)-naproxen
Lahmann, Martina,Bergstroem, Moa,Turek, Dominika,Oscarson, Stefan
, p. 123 - 132 (2007/10/03)
A general procedure for the synthesis of 1-O-acyl-β-D-glucuronic acids using the benzyl 1-O-trichloroacetimidoyl-2,3,4-tri-O-benzyl-D- glucopyranuronate 6 as donor is exemplified by the synthesis of the urine metabolites of (S)-naproxen, desmethyl (S)-naproxen, indoprofen, and carboxymefloquine. The key intermediate benzyl 2,3,4-tri-O-benzyl-D- glucopyranuronate 5 is easily accessible in four steps (29%) from the peracetylated β-D-glucuronic acid 1. Copyright
